                                       This year’s event will feature the third edition of the Make it in the Emirates Awards, presented
                                       across nine categories under five strategic pillars: Factory of the Future, Excellence in National
                                       ICV, Industrial Enablers and Strategic Partners, Leadership and Talent, and UAE Traditional Crafts
                                       for Individual and Companies.
                                       The UAE Traditional Crafts category is introduced for the first time, aiming to support creative
                                       industries and preserve Emirati heritage by empowering artisans through incentives, showcasing
                                       their creations, and providing platforms to market their products.
                                       The second day will see the unveiling of the ICV Champions, a newly introduced initiative
                                       debuting this year. It will recognise and honour companies excelling in the National ICV
                                       Program across eight categories, in appreciation of their exceptional contributions to advancing
                                       industrial development in the UAE.
                                       The fourth edition will feature a Startup Pitch Competition focused artificial intelligence. The
                                       competition aims to attract and support emerging industrial innovations, integrating them into
                                       the national industrial ecosystem.
                                       The press conference also provided an overview of the investment opportunities and incentives
                                       presented by Make it in the Emirates. Manufacturers and investors will be able to benefit from a
                                       wide range of investment enablers including a business-friendly environment, technological
                                       transformation, competitive financing, industrial sustainability, business growth support,
                                       production and export promotion, and more.
                                       The fourth edition is set to be the largest yet, and will feature an expanded range of products
                                       offered for local manufacturing, along with an increase in procurement agreements to support
                                       industrial diversification and sustainability in the country.
                                       Startups will receive special attention within the event’s agenda, with dedicated platforms to
                                       showcase their products and pitch innovative ideas to a select group of investors, decision-
                                       makers, and enablers.

                                       Make it in the Emirates aims to amplify the economic and social impact of the National Strategy
                                       for Industry and Advanced Technology. It focuses on localiing supply chains, fostering industrial
                                       growth through strategic partnerships, enablers, and investment opportunities. It also highlights
                                       the role of AI in shaping the future of industry, offering competitive financing and technological
                                       transformation solutions to strengthen partnerships, promote innovative products, facilitate
                                       knowledge exchange, unlock new avenues of innovation, and empower startups.
